Advancing Sustainable Dyeing and Printing with KR-711B Solutions
The textile industry is undergoing a significant transformation, with sustainability becoming a core principle guiding innovation. NINGBO INNO PHARMCHEM CO.,LTD. is proud to contribute to this evolution with KR-711B, a key component in sustainable dyeing and printing technologies that marry high performance with environmental responsibility.
Our Pigment Printing Thickener KR-711B is meticulously formulated as an APEO-free formaldehyde-free textile chemical, addressing critical concerns regarding harmful substances in textile production. This commitment to green chemistry enables manufacturers to produce textiles with a reduced environmental footprint, aligning with global efforts for a more sustainable future. As a dedicated green textile chemicals supplier, NINGBO INNO PHARMCHEM CO.,LTD. ensures that its products support both ecological integrity and product excellence.
KR-711B's advanced properties not only promote sustainability but also enhance overall process efficiency. Its exceptional stability and potent thickening capacity allow for precise application and vibrant color yields, minimizing waste and resource consumption. This means that embracing eco-conscious printing solutions does not require a compromise on quality or performance. The thickener's robust electrolyte resistance also contributes to a more stable and efficient dyeing process, regardless of formulation complexities.
